Abstract
The invention relates to a signal output device of a heating container. The device comprises a hollow shell with one open end, a curve-type pipe with one open end and a signal generating device; the shell is provided with an air outlet and an interface which is communicated with a pressure relief hole; the air outlet and the opening of the curve-type pipe are communicated and are in hermetic seal; the interface is provided with a pressure relief valve; and the sealed end of the curve-type pipe drives the signal generating device. Because the structure is adopted, the shell is communicated with the inner cavity of the heating container, the pressure in the heating container enters into the shell and the curve-type pipe, under the effect of the pressure, the curve-type pipe performs straightening movement, the sealed end of the curve-type pipe drives the signal generating device, and the signal generating device outputs signals to a control device of the heating container; the curve-type pipe is ageing-resistant and has long service life; and the defects of reduction in sealing performance and reduction in accuracy rate in the prior art are overcome.

Background technology
Present prior art, application for a patent for invention number: 201010550695.2, invention and created name: the pressure sensor that a kind of electric pressure cooking saucepan is used, it comprises having under shed cylinder barrel, piston, compression spring and potentiometer; Piston and cylinder barrel are slidably matched and the liquid hermetic seal, and compression spring one end coordinates with piston, the other end coordinates with the top board of cylinder barrel; On the cylinder barrel arm, pilot hole is arranged, actuating arm is connected with piston and stretches out pilot hole, and actuating arm drives potentiometer, and the cylinder barrel wall between piston and cylinder barrel top board has limit relief hole.Existing problems are: along with use, spring is aging, and piston and cylinder barrel sealing property descend, and have reduced accuracy rate.
